McClatchy got themselves on the board against Grant on Wednesday, but Grant never followed suit. They blew past the Pacers 16-0. Considering the Lions have won seven matchups by more than seven runs this season, Wednesday's blowout was nothing new.
Diego DiFiore made a splash while hitting and pitching. He looked comfortable on the mound, pitching two innings while giving up no earned runs or hits. He has been consistent recently: he hasn't given up more than one walk in four consecutive appearances. He was also solid in the batter's box, scoring two runs and stealing a base while getting on base in two of his three plate appearances.
In other batting news, the team relied heavily on Antonio Barber, who went 3-for-5 with two runs, one triple, and one stolen base. That's the most hits he has posted since back in April of 2024. Another player making a difference was Elias Ortega, who scored a run and stole two bases while going 1-for-2.
McClatchy hit smart and finished the game with only one strikeout. The team has now struck out at least five strikeouts batters in seven consecutive contests.
McClatchy's record now sits at 13-1. As for Grant, they dropped their record down to 4-12 with the defeat, which was their sixth straight at home.
McClatchy will have a chance to go back-to-back against the Pacers: the pair's next game is a rematch scheduled at 4:20 p.m. on Friday.
